ALEXANDRIA, Va., May 5 -- United States Patent no. 12,619,573, issued on May 5, was assigned to Microchip Technology Inc. (Chandler, Ariz.).
"Systems and methods for operating a serial peripheral interface (SPI) network" was invented by Naveen Raj (Chandler, Ariz.), Christian Pillonel (Cheyres, Switzerland), Cristian Androne (Bucharest, Romania) and Yann Johner (Preverenges, Switzerland).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"A system includes a master device and multiple slave devices connected in a daisy chain arrangement, and configured to communicate according to a serial peripheral device interface (SPI) protocol.
